Get ready to transform your remote work experience and unlock new levels of productivity and innovation with the power of AI. ## Understanding the AI in 2025: Key Trends and Developments The AI of 2025 is characterized by several major trends that have moved beyond concept into widespread adoption. Generative AI, for example, has evolved significantly, no longer just producing text or images, but also complex video, 3D models, and even functional code. The integration of AI directly into everyday software platforms is also more pervasive than ever, meaning you no longer need to be a data scientist to benefit from AI's power. Tools are becoming more user-friendly, with intuitive interfaces and lower barriers to entry. Furthermore, ethical considerations and regulatory frameworks are starting to mature, influencing how AI is developed and deployed. One key development is the rise of **multi-modal AI**, where models can understand and generate content across different data types – text, images, audio, and video – simultaneously. This opens up entirely new possibilities for content creation, communication analysis, and complex problem-solving. For a remote team collaborating on a marketing campaign, this could mean AI drafting video scripts based on written prompts and then generating initial visual concepts, all tied together by a consistent brand voice. Another significant trend is **AI explainability (XAI)**. As AI systems become more sophisticated and are used for critical decision-making, understanding *how* they arrive at their conclusions is paramount. Tools in 2025 are increasingly incorporating features that provide transparency into their decision-making processes, which is especially important for areas like financial analysis or medical diagnostics where ethical considerations are high. This transparency helps build trust and allows users to validate the AI's output, crucial for professionals in regulated industries or those dealing with sensitive data. The democratization of AI is another undeniable force. Cloud-based AI services, often offered on a pay-as-you-go model, have made advanced AI capabilities accessible to individuals and small businesses that previously couldn't afford the infrastructure. Platforms like Google Cloud AI, Amazon Web Services (AWS) AI/ML, and Microsoft Azure AI services have expanded their offerings to include pre-trained models for various tasks, reducing the need for extensive data science expertise. This means a solo entrepreneur in [Chiang Mai](/cities/chiang-mai) can now the same powerful AI technology as a large corporation to analyze market trends, automate customer support, or personalize their marketing efforts. The focus has shifted from *building* AI models from scratch to *applying* and *fine-tuning* existing, powerful models to specific organizational needs. This shift is particularly beneficial for digital nomads and remote teams who often operate with limited resources and specialized technical staff. From predictive analytics to automated reporting, these tools provide accessible insights that were once only available to large enterprises with dedicated data science departments. ### Automated Data Cleaning and Transformation Before any meaningful analysis can occur, data often needs extensive cleaning and preparation. This can be one of the most time-consuming aspects of data work. AI tools like DataRobot's Automated Data Prep or advancements in platforms like Trifacta Data Wrangler are dramatically simplifying this. They can automatically identify missing values, detect anomalies, standardize formats, and even suggest optimal transformations based on the desired analysis. For remote data analysts, this means less time wrestling with messy spreadsheets and more time extracting valuable insights. * Practical Tip: While AI automates much of the data cleaning, always maintain a basic understanding of your data sources and any potential biases. Automated cleaning, while powerful, should still be monitored and, at times, manually adjusted to ensure data integrity and domain-specific considerations.
  • Real-world Example: A remote market research consultant based in Budapest uses an AI data preparation tool to clean customer feedback data from various sources (surveys, social media, support tickets) before feeding it into her sentiment analysis models. This ensures consistent input and more reliable outputs. ### Advanced Predictive Analytics Platforms Predictive analytics is no longer just for financial forecasting.   • Internal Link: Visit our About Us page to learn more about our mission to support remote professionals. ## AI for Security and Privacy Concerns in Remote Work As AI becomes more integrated into our workflows, understanding and mitigating the associated security and privacy risks is paramount, especially for digital nomads who often work from various locations and use different networks. ### AI-Powered Cybersecurity Tools In 2025, AI is at the forefront of digital security. Tools are now far more sophisticated in detecting and responding to threats. AI-driven Endpoint Detection and Response (EDR) systems can identify unusual behavior on devices that might indicate a hack, going beyond traditional antivirus signatures. Behavioral biometrics use AI to authenticate users based on how they type, move their mouse, or interact with their device, providing a continuous layer of security. For remote workers, these tools offer advanced protection against phishing, malware, and insider threats. * Practical Tip: Implement multi-factor authentication (MFA) everywhere possible. While AI tools are powerful, MFA remains one of the simplest yet most effective layers of defense against unauthorized access.
  • Real-world Example: A digital nomad working in Kyoto relies on an AI-powered next-gen firewall and an EDR solution installed on her laptop. The AI monitors her network traffic and device activity, immediately flagging any suspicious processes or connections, helping her work securely even from public Wi-Fi networks.
  • Internal Link: Check out our essential guide on Remote Work Security Best Practices. ### Data Privacy and Compliance Management With increasing data privacy regulations like GDPR and CCPA, managing data ethically and compliantly is a major challenge. AI tools are emerging to assist with this, especially for remote teams processing data across jurisdictions. AI-powered data discovery and classification tools can scan databases and documents to identify sensitive information (PII, financial data) and ensure it's handled according to policy. AI-driven consent management platforms automate the process of obtaining and managing user consent for data usage, reducing the risk of non-compliance. * Practical Tip: Understand the data privacy regulations relevant to your clients and the locations you operate from. Utilize AI tools to assist with compliance but ensure you also have a human expert regularly reviewing your data handling practices.
  • Real-world Example: A remote startup provides a global SaaS product. They use an AI privacy management tool to automatically discover and map personal data across their diverse databases and cloud services, ensuring they comply with different regional data protection laws and minimizing their regulatory risk. ### Ethical AI Considerations Beyond security, the ethical implications of AI are becoming a more prominent concern in 2025. Real-world Example: A remote team with members in London, New York, and Sydney uses an AI scheduler that integrates with everyone's calendars and suggests meeting times that minimize inconvenience for all participants, often leveraging an AI meeting assistant for summaries for anyone who can't attend. ### Data Sovereignty and Compliance Across Borders As digital nomads, you might work from many countries, and your clients might be based in others. Data sovereignty laws (where data is physically stored and subject to local laws) and international data transfer regulations are complex. When choosing AI tools, especially cloud-based ones, understand where data is processed and stored. Ensure your usage complies with relevant data protection laws for both your location and your clients' locations. Practical Tip: Look for AI service providers that offer data residency options, allowing you to choose the geographical location of your data storage. Always review their data processing agreements (DPAs) and privacy policies. ### Cost-Effectiveness and Scalability Many AI tools operate on a subscription or pay-as-you-go model.
